Job Description

About the Role
As a Plumber with my client you will be responsible for general preventive maintenance repair testing installation and troubleshooting of plumbing mechanical and distribution systems throughout a facility. This role is part of the Engineering and Technical Services function providing critical support preventive maintenance and repairs on equipment and systems to ensure smooth facility operations.

What Youll Do

  • Repair install replace test and troubleshoot water and medical gas supply/distribution systems.

  • Install new water systems piping and fixtures according to blueprints drawings specifications and applicable codes.

  • Ensure waste and vent lines are in proper working condition using tools such as plumbers snake vacuum plunger or jet washer.

  • Support staff or contractors on projects or equipment installations.

  • Perform both minor and major repairs on faucets toilets flush valves pressure relief/reducing valves and other fixtures.

  • Operate threading machines; remove replace and repair all sizes and types of piping (cast plastic stainless black iron copper glass Victaulic).

  • Work on heating cooling domestic cold water pumps heat exchangers humidifiers boilers and urinals.

  • Troubleshoot rebuild or replace pumps (submersible sump centrifugal piston).

  • Perform soldering brazing and open-flame welding (up to 4 pipe).

  • Use material management systems to minimize waste and maintain proper inventory.

  • Estimate jobs prepare material lists and support invoicing/billing processes.

  • Conduct plumbing safety inspections and backflow device testing.

  • Train staff members to perform light plumbing maintenance and repairs.

  • Carry out general maintenance and building operational duties as assigned.

  • Respond to emergency situations and coordinate additional support when required.

  • Adhere to all HSE policies programs and procedures including safety inspections incident investigations and compliance reporting.

What Youll Need

  • High School Diploma GED or trade school diploma with 45 years of job-related experience. Equivalent education/experience combinations considered.

  • Plumbing certification at the Journeyman level required. Medical Gas and Backflow certifications preferred.

  • Valid Drivers License required. Supervisory or shift manager experience preferred.

  • Ability to meet physical demands (stooping standing walking climbing lifting/carrying 50 lbs.).

  • Strong judgment and analytical skills with the ability to assess multiple information sources.

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Word Excel Outlook etc.).

  • Strong organizational skills and an inquisitive solutions-oriented mindset.
